site stats

Table lock ssis

WebJun 16, 2024 · At the table level, there are five different types of locks: Exclusive (X) Shared (S) Intent exclusive (IX) Intent shared (IS) Shared with intent exclusive (SIX) Compatibility … WebLocking in the Database Engine Lock granularity and hierarchies Lock modes Lock compatibility Key-range locking Lock escalation Lock escalation without optimized locking Lock escalation with optimized locking Dynamic locking Lock partitioning Row versioning-based isolation levels in the SQL Server Database Engine

NoLock and Table Lock in SSIS

WebOct 5, 2024 · Figure 2 – SSIS OLE DB Destination fast load options Selecting table manually vs. using variables There are two ways to pass the destination table name to the SSIS OLE DB Destination: Selecting the name manually from a … http://thinknook.com/8-ways-to-optimize-your-ssis-package-2013-06-28/ download msme registration certificate https://vortexhealingmidwest.com

How to Find and Remove Table Lock in Oracle - orahow

WebThe correct way to use LOCK TABLES and UNLOCK TABLES with transactional tables, such as InnoDB tables, is to begin a transaction with SET autocommit = 0 (not START … WebMar 30, 2024 · Lock escalation is the process of converting many fine-grained locks (such as row or page locks) to table locks. Microsoft SQL Server dynamically determines when … WebJun 6, 2024 · In order to maintain ACID mechanisms, in SQL Server, a lock is maintained. By using Azure Data Studio, let us see the concepts of the Lock mechanism by starting with … classic car sales in iowa

SQL Server, Locks object - SQL Server Microsoft Learn

Category:SQL Server table hints - WITH (NOLOCK) best practices

Tags:Table lock ssis

Table lock ssis

Table Lock in Ole Db Destination and No Lock in SP

WebDec 12, 2016 · A practical example of SQL Server blocking is when Transaction #1 is trying to update data in Table A, and while Transaction #1 is still running and is not completed, Transaction #2 tries to place a new lock on Table A; If the row that should be deleted is also the row that will be updated by Transaction #2, then Transaction #2 will encounter a ... WebJun 28, 2013 · Whether each SSIS package inserts into a separate staging table which then gets switched into one staging table (ideal), or SSIS itself inserts into specific partitions of the staging table (you’ll need to take out table-lock escalation), partitioning (when done correctly) should eleminate any bottlenecks to do with sql engine table lock specific …

Table lock ssis

Did you know?

WebTable locks can be acquired for base tables or views. You must have the LOCK TABLES privilege, and the SELECT privilege for each object to be locked. For view locking, LOCK … WebSep 20, 2024 · Each query would read a different chunk of data from the source table, and insert without problems on the destination table, if you use OLEDB Destination you could edit the options to uncheck the option to lock the destination table, and use a batch size below 5000 rows, since above 5000 rows, the rows are writed first on the temp db, and then ...

WebJun 14, 2012 · Table Lock – By default this setting is checked and the recommendation is to let it be checked unless the same table is being used by some other process at same … WebAug 15, 2015 · Here is a quick script which will help users to identify locked tables in the SQL Server. When you run above script, it will display table name and lock on it. I have written code to lock the person table in the database. After locking the database, when I ran above script – it gave us following resultset.

WebLOCK TABLE command in SQL is used to prevent deadlocks and concurrent data changes and modifications to maintain consistency and atomicity of transactions on database … WebOct 31, 2016 · The "Check Constraints" checkbox on an OLE DB destination task controls whether Check Constraints on the OLE DB destination are evaluated when performing bulk data inserts by the SSIS package or not. I explore how to leverage OLE DB Table Lock setting to control the quality of the data migration.

WebMar 30, 2024 · Table level: You can disable lock escalation at the table level. See ALTER TABLE ... SET (LOCK_ESCALATION = DISABLE). To determine which table to target, examine the T-SQL queries. If that's not possible, use Extended events, enable the lock_escalation event, and examine the object_id column.

WebTable locks can be acquired for base tables or views. You must have the LOCK TABLES privilege, and the SELECT privilege for each object to be locked. For view locking, LOCK TABLES adds all base tables used in the view to the set of tables to be locked and locks them automatically. classic car sales norfolk ukWebAug 1, 2024 · Table locking is used (see how to set locks below) There are two operations that get logged, data page updates and index page updates. The following chart shows you when and how things will be logged in the transaction log when issuing a bulk load command. Databases in Simple and Bulk-Logged Recovery download msme udyam certificateWebOct 24, 2016 · When “Table Lock” is unchecked, an Intent Exclusive Lock is acquired on the table, indicating granular exclusive locks in use Please note that between each run, the … download msn as homepage for windows 7WebFeb 11, 2010 · Answers. At the time of reading the data from a single table, there is no such problem. but it is good practice to use NO LOCK. But if multiple flows are writing the data to same table (with the property of Oledb destination is checked as Table Lock) , … classic car sales 1963 tbird new jerseyWebApr 22, 2024 · Table Lock: This option creates a SQL Server lock on the target table, preventing inserts and updates other than the records you are inserting. This option speeds up your process but may cause a production outage, … download msn browser freeWebMay 23, 2024 · SSIS locking table while updating it. I have an SSIS package which when runs, updates a table. It is using a staging table and subsequently, uses slowly changing … classic car sales marylanddownload msnbc app for laptop